Analysis Summary
CVE-2020-16935
An elevation of privilege vulnerability exists when Windows improperly handles COM object creation, aka ‘Windows COM Server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ability’. An attacker who successfully exploited the vulnerability could run arbitrary code with elevated privileges. To exploit this vulnerability, an attacker would first have to log on to the system. An attacker could then run a specially crafted application that could exploit the vulnerability and take control of an affected system.
Impact
- Privilege Escalation
- Code Execution
- System Takeover
Affected Vendors
Microsoft
Affected Products
- Microsoft Windows 10
- Microsoft Windows 7
- Microsoft Windows 8.1
- Windows RT 8.1
- Windows Server 2008
- Microsoft Windows Server 2012
- Windows Server 2016
- Microsoft Windows Server 2019
- Windows Server
- version 1903 (Server Core installation)
- version 1909 (Server Core installation)
- version 2004 (Server Core installation)
Remediation
Updates are available. Update to latest version.
